PASBO established an Admission of Exhibitor Representative and Reasonable Standard of Conduct to ensure a positive exhibit environment for business associates and members. Exhibiting companies wishing to utilize the services of individuals other than their own associates, such as celebrities, entertainers, authors, etc., are required to seek approval for the activity 60 days in advance of the PASBO sponsored event to the attention of the PASBO Executive Director. The request shall include an overview of the proposed activity and provide enough detail to address how the activity will be conducted. Activities that are foreseen to be potentially disruptive to other exhibitors or violate the reasonable standard of conduct will not be approved. The reasonable standard of conduct shall consist of representatives not being rude or offensive toward members or other exhibitors. Questionable dress that is considered too casual or revealing and entertainment that is excessively loud or unsuitable for an educational conference will be prohibited. PASBO reserves the right to terminate any activities and remove offending members during a PASBO event for failure to comply with the standard as defined. Non-employees of an exhibiting company will not be permitted access to the event without the prior approval of the PASBO Executive Director. Exhibiting companies failing to follow this procedure may be removed without refund and/or barred from future PASBO events for violations of this reasonable standard of conduct. |

A portion of the exhibit booth rental fee ($25) is used by the Exhibitors Advisory Committee to purchase prizes that will be distributed to members from drawings held several times each day in the exhibit area. During the conference exhibitors may award prizes at their booths during exhibit hours and post winners to the bulletin board near the General Registration Desk. PASBO is not responsible for individual exhibitor prizes. |
